At Colourcraft, we were privileged to work with Te Taura Whiri i te Reo Māori, the Māori Language Commission to produce a series of A2 and A3 Paylite panels for their office. Using graphics provided by the client, we created 14 high-quality panels in sizes ranging from A3 to A2.
Each panel was printed in full colour on premium Avery Dennison vinyl, ensuring rich, vibrant tones. The prints were mounted on 6mm thick Paylite and finished with a matt lamination, sealing the graphics and enhancing durability. This finishing touch creates a refined, non-reflective surface, ideal for high-traffic areas.
To achieve these vibrant and long-lasting results, we used our Roland XR-640 printer, known for its exceptional print quality. Equipped with eco-solvent ink technology, the XR-640 produces vivid, resilient prints that are water, wear, and UV-resistant – the perfect solution for durable and eye-catching displays like those created for Te Taura Whiri i te Reo Māori.

Sharp Enough to Deal: Custom Playing Card Decks for Simfuni
Simfuni is an Auckland-based insurtech company that helps insurance businesses ditch legacy platforms and modernise their operations. So when they needed a promotional tool that could make that message land in person, at conferences, in sales meetings, with investors. A custom playing card deck was a smart move. The concept: a tongue-in-cheek deck called *Are You Still Gambling on Legacy Platforms?* The execution had to match the brand. Premium feel, clean print, and packaging that looked the part.
We produced 100 sets of 54 playing cards, sized at 63 × 88mm, printed double-sided in full colour on 300gsm Pro Digital Silk stock. Each card was matt laminated on both sides for a smooth, scuff-resistant finish, then die-cut to size and weeded of waste. Cards were packed into custom-printed tuck-in cartons, produced on 260gsm Tiger FBB cartonboard, matt laminated on the face, die-cut and glued, creating a complete, finished product ready to hand over or ship out.
Print was handled on our Konica Minolta AccurioPress C4070 with integrated quality control that checks colour and registration in real time across every sheet. No drift, no inconsistency. What you approve in proof is what comes off the press. Carton die-cutting was done on our JWEI 6040, which handles custom shapes without expensive tooling or setup delays, keeping the project moving efficiently.
We supplied artwork templates, managed the proofing process for both cards and cartons, and guided the client through a smooth approval. There was a time pressure element too, a portion of the decks were needed ahead of an overseas event, so getting the proofing and sign-off process right first time mattered. Clear communication on both sides meant the project moved from artwork submission to approved proof without revisions, and into production on schedule.
The result was a professional, premium card deck, produced in Wellington and ready to travel.

Smart, Scalable Print: Custom Keg Collars for Hallertau Brewery
Nestled in Riverhead, just outside Auckland, Hallertau Brewery is a pioneer of New Zealand’s modern craft beer scene — and one of our longest-standing keg collar clients. With an ever-evolving lineup of beers and a commitment to freshness, they needed a way to brand kegs clearly and consistently across dozens of SKUs, without slowing down production or adding friction for their team.
We’ve produced tens of thousands of flat keg collars for Hallertau since 2017, using a standardised setup we’ve refined to serve over 30 breweries across New Zealand. Every collar is printed on sturdy 284gsm Formakote Natura board, diecut to a precise 93 × 186mm, and supplied flat for efficient storage and quick application. Colours stay sharp, even after time in the chiller — and we keep their artwork, samples, and print settings on file for fast, repeatable reprints with no colour surprises.
Static details: beer name, style, ABV, branding, are pre-printed, with space left for batch codes and dates to be added on site. It’s a practical, repeatable system that keeps quality high and turnaround times low.
We offer two keg collar formats: the flat style used by Hallertau (simple, cost-effective, reliable), and a folding version — like the one we produce for Ground Up Brewing — that locks the tap badge in place for extra hold during transport. Both are built on the same print specs, using shared dies and structures developed in-house, meaning consistent results, sharp pricing, and faster turnarounds no matter your format.

Thoughtful, Sustainable Packaging That Helped GrowProbe Go from Prototype to Market
When GrowProbe was ready to bring their innovative indoor plant moisture probe to market, they needed packaging that did more than just look good — it had to hold the product securely, be cost-effective and align with their eco-conscious values. The product wasn’t yet in stores, so the packaging had to make a strong first impression for online sales and future retail opportunities.
The client came to us with a draft backing card structure and the need for an interlocking feature to keep the probe in place. We refined the design to improve fit and function, suggested printing on both sides of a single-sided Kraftpak Kraft 283gsm board and produced multiple prototypes to perfect the form before committing to cutting tooling. This process allowed us to get the locking system right and create packaging that feels as considered as the product itself.
The final packaging was printed black on both sides, die-cut to shape and delivered with a natural kraft aesthetic that complements GrowProbe’s sustainable brand. The product launched smoothly, gaining traction online and through social media, with a reprint order following a few years later — proof that the design continues to perform.

Emporio Coffee: Custom Stickers for a Wellington Coffee Icon
When long-time client Emporio Coffee marked their 20th year in business, they trusted us once again to deliver. As one of Wellington’s original independent roasters, Emporio has built a reputation on quality and consistency - values that align perfectly with how we approach print. For this milestone, they needed high-quality branded stickers that could be applied to coffee bags across their retail and wholesale network.
We produced 15,000 circle stickers at 60mm diameter, printed on pre-cut blanks using our Ricoh C9100 digital press. The result was sharp colour, precise alignment, and a finish that held up well. We supplied the stickers as un-weeded A4 sheets, making them easy for the Emporio team to use in-house. Fast turnaround and flawless output meant they had what they needed, right on schedule.
